Calibrating Your Adjustable Bed: Ensuring Consistent Print Quality

Importance of proper Calibration

Achieving a consistent print quality with your 3D printer largely hinges on meticulous calibration of your adjustable bed. A well-calibrated bed not only ensures the first layer adheres properly to the print surface but also prevents issues such as warping or print failures. When bed height is uneven or improperly leveled, even the most carefully designed model can come out poorly, leading to wasted time and material.

Steps for Effective Calibration

To effectively calibrate your adjustable bed,follow these actionable steps:

  • Initial Assessment: Begin by visually inspecting the bed for any obstructions or debris that may interfere with leveling.
  • Home the Printer: use your printer’s homing function to set the nozzle to the starting position. This provides a consistent reference point.
  • Use a Paper Test: Slide a standard piece of paper between the nozzle and the bed. Adjust the height until a slight resistance is felt when sliding the paper.
  • Diagonal Leveling: Repeat this test at all four corners of the bed as well as the center. Adjust the screws or leveling knobs accordingly to achieve a uniform height.
  • test Print: Once adjustments are made, perform a small test print to evaluate adhesion and print quality. Observe how well the first layer adheres; if there are issues, recheck the calibration.

Maintenance Tips

Consistency is key; thus, maintaining your calibration settings is essential. Regularly check the bed’s level, especially if you’ve moved your printer or changed filament types, as variations in material can affect bed adhesion. Additionally,consider the following maintenance tips:

  • Habitat Check: ensure your printer is in a stable environment free of drafts or temperature fluctuations that can impact print quality.
  • Surface Cleaning: Keep the print bed clean from any residues or oils that might have accumulated during use.
  • Leveling Routine: Create a routine to check bed levels before major prints, especially if your projects demand high precision.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with Adjustable Beds for 3D Printing

When it comes to 3D printing, achieving the ideal first layer adhesion can sometimes feel like navigating a complex maze. An adjustable bed has the potential to enhance your printing results significantly,yet it can also introduce unique challenges. Whether your print is popping off mid-process or not sticking at all,understanding how to effectively troubleshoot these common issues is crucial.

Common Bed Adhesion Problems

Let’s start with the typical problems you might encounter:

  • Inconsistent Adhesion: If your prints are not adhering properly, it may stem from an improper Z-offset setting. It’s essential to ensure that the nozzle is neither too close nor too far from the bed. Adjust the Z-offset until you find the sweet spot that allows the filament to adhere without being squished or overly distanced.
  • Warped Bed Surface: A warped bed can lead to uneven distances between the nozzle and the print surface, affecting adhesion. to resolve this, use a metal ruler to check for flatness across the bed, especially when heated. Making micro-adjustments can greatly enhance the print surface uniformity.
  • Incorrect Bed Temperature: The bed temperature needs to be set according to the material you are printing with. For example, PLA typically prints best at temperatures around 60°C. If the bed is too cool, prints may lift or warp, while too hot may cause excess ooze.

Optimizing Your slicer Settings

Another crucial element in ensuring effective adhesion involves your slicer settings. Key adjustments include:

Setting Recommended Value
First Layer Height 0.2 – 0.3 mm
Initial Layer Speed 10 – 20 mm/s
Bed Adhesive Options Glue stick, hairspray, painter’s tape

Modifying the first layer speed helps in achieving better adhesion as it allows the filament to settle more effectively on the bed. Additionally,using common adhesives like glue sticks,hairspray,or painter’s tape can promote a strong bond between the filament and the bed surface,combating potential lifting issues.

maintenance Tips to Keep your Adjustable Bed in Peak Condition

To maintain your adjustable bed and ensure it operates at peak performance, it’s crucial to adopt a series of proactive maintenance practices. An adjustable bed can significantly enhance your 3D printing experience by providing better bed leveling and adherence, thereby achieving higher print quality. Here are essential maintenance tips to help you keep your setup in optimal condition.

Regular Cleaning

Dust and debris accumulation can lead to printing inconsistencies and adhesion issues. To prevent this, regularly clean the print bed with a soft cloth and a mild solvent such as isopropyl alcohol. This step removes any residues that could interfere with print quality. Additionally, ensure the nozzle is free from obstructions by cleaning it periodically.

Check Bed Leveling Frequently

A well-leveled bed is the cornerstone of successful printing.It’s advisable to check the bed leveling each time you change the filament or notice any changes in print quality. Many users find that using a piece of paper as a spacing tool provides excellent results. Adjust the height of each corner of the bed until a slight resistance is felt when sliding the paper. This simplicity in approach is crucial for optimal print results, especially when implementing an adjustable bed setup.

Lubricate Moving parts

Maintaining the moving components of your adjustable bed is just as significant as the bed itself. Lubricate rods and bearings with a suitable lubricant every few months. This practice ensures smooth operation and prolongs the life of your printer’s mechanics, thus maintaining precise movement which is essential for high-quality prints.

Monitor for Wear and Tear

Like any mechanical system, your adjustable bed can experience wear and tear over time. Regularly inspect components such as belts, gears, and connections for signs of damage. Addressing any issues early can prevent more significant problems down the line.for instance, if you notice a frayed belt, replace it instantly to avoid ruining your print or causing misalignment during operation.
